Azitra has canceled its special stockholder meeting, initially set for March 6, 2026, indicating potential governance issues. The company continues to develop its key clinical programs, ATR-12 and ATR-04, which may impact its future funding and operational strategies.
While the cancelled meeting raises governance flags, there are no immediate changes to operations or clinical outcomes; thus, it carries a neutral sentiment.
